TULSA, OK -- A piece of flying history is spending the next few days in Tulsa. It's a World War II-era Boeing B-17 nicknamed Aluminum Overcast.
The plane has been meticulously restored. The old bomber is owned by the Experimental Aircraft Association, based in Wisconsin.
It will be flying out of Jones Riverside Airport through Sunday, and you can buy a half-hour ride for about $400.
